WHAT YOU’LL NEED TO SUCCEED:

Education: BA/BS in Information Technology or related field or the equivalent combination of education, technical certifications or training, or work experience.

Experience: 15+ years of related

Required technical skills:

Demonstrated experience in all phases of the Operation and Maintenance (O&M) Software Lifecycle model, tracking issues and managing trouble tickets, testing software, writing test cases, and performance testing.

Demonstrated experience with ServiceNow.

Demonstrated experience using COGNOS and IBM SPSS Statistics, understanding SPSS syntax, and experience converting it into Cognos reports.

Demonstrated experience using Oracle SQL and TM1.

Demonstrated experience with JavaScript/JQuery/AJAX, HTML/CSS, Angular, or similar frameworks used to develop and implement User Interface and application components within the platform.

Demonstrated experience utilizing Update Sets in conjunction with the lifecycle management and promotion of features and bug fixes throughout the environment stack.

Demonstrated experience using ServicePortal for UI Development of web interfaces.

Demonstrated experience developing and maintaining applications to meet required Accessibility standards (Section 508 and more robust WCAG and organizational standards).

Demonstrated experience with HR-related and customer-specific datasets including limitations of those datasets and system/data flow dynamics.

Demonstrated experience with Unit Testing, System/Integration Testing, and User Acceptance testing concepts and activities in the customer environment.

Demonstrated experience using customer-approved DevSecOps tools and concepts to support the Security-focused design of highly usable and dynamic applications.

Demonstrated experience with .NET MVC web application design and development.

Demonstrated experience with Linux and Windows Cloud Server management.

Demonstrated experience managing Cloud infrastructure through cloud-native scripting languages and must-use enterprise tools and frameworks.

Demonstrated experience with the ICD-503 process for accrediting applications and systems within the sponsor network, including submission of evidence, and leading remediation efforts to address any risks or identified issues.

Certifications: ServiceNow

Security Clearance Level: TS/SCI with Polygraph

Desired skills:

Demonstrated experience with HR systems and tools

Demonstrated experience with large datasets

Demonstrated experience with survey administration and response analysis

Demonstrated experience with Tableau, Power BI, or other data analytics tools

Demonstrated experience with Project Management principles and Agile Development principles to assist with the planning, development, testing, and execution of a project and project activities

Demonstrated experience with the RMF Framework along with Agile principles to ensure the effective mitigation of risk while operating in a dynamic Agile environment
